Model Selection是指在機器學習中,從多個模型中選擇最優模型的過程。模型是指一個數學模型,該模型被訓練使用以預測特定問題的答案或結果。模型選擇的目標是在適當的精度和複雜性之間取得平衡,以避免過度擬合或低估而導致的問題。
舉例來說,當我們使用線性回歸進行房價預測時,可能會遇到不同的線性回歸模型,例如普通最小二乘法(Ordinary Least Squares)、Ridge Regression和Lasso Regression等。在這種情況下,我們需要使用模型選擇來選擇最適合的模型。可以通過交叉驗證等技術,比較這些模型的性能並選擇最佳模型。最終,我們可以使用選定的模型進行房價預測,並且確定該模型是最適合解決我們的問題的。
选择正确的模型类型:根据问题的性质和数据的特征选择合适的模型,例如线性回归、决策树、支持向量机等。
训练集和测试集的划分:将数据集分为训练集和测试集,训练集用于训练模型,测试集用于评估模型的表现。
常用的模型选择方法:交叉验证、留一验证、Bootstrap方法等。
评估模型表现的指标:平均绝对误差(MAE)、均方误差(MSE)、决定系数(R2)、交叉熵等。
超参数调整:调整模型的超参数,例如学习率、正则化系数等,以提高模型的准确度。
集成学习:通过多个模型的集成以提高模型的准确度和稳定性。
模型的解释性:理解模型的决策过程,以便对模型进行进一步的优化和改进。
哪些参数需要在使用机器学习演算法时进行选择,以最佳化模型性能?
如何在多个候选模型之间进行选择?
如何在使用机器学习演算法时选择适当的评估指标?
什么是过度拟合和欠拟合?如何避免这些问题?
在使用深度学习演算法时,如何选择适当的网路结构和超参数?
答案: